Blue Cash Preferred Card from American Express wins 3 of 5 criteria here, making it the stronger all-rounder.

Blue Cash Preferred Card from American Express wins on first-year math, earning ceiling, and travel insurance; Capital One Platinum Credit Card wins on annual fee and foreign transactions.

Pick the Blue Cash Preferred Card from American Express if year-one math is your priority; take the Capital One Platinum Credit Card if you want a cheaper card to keep long-term.
